Statusbot: Unterschied zwischen den Versionen

Aus RaumZeitLabor Wiki
K (Info zum Daemon)
Zeile 19: Zeile 19:


=== IRC ===
=== IRC ===
In den Räumen #oqlt und #raumzeitlabor (hackint) kann der Status via ''!!raum'' abgefragt werden.
In den Räumen #oqlt und #raumzeitlabor (hackint) kann der Status via ''!!raum'' abgefragt werden. Zusätzlich können über '!weristda' die anwesenden RaumZeitLaboranten ausgegeben werden. Voraussetzung hierfür ist, dass diese in der [[BenutzerDB]] die MAC-Adressen ihrer Netzwerkadapter hinterlegt haben.
Mit !stream wird der aktuell über den MPD abgespielte Musiktitel angezeigt.
Mit !stream wird der aktuell über den MPD abgespielte Musiktitel angezeigt.



Version vom 4. November 2012, 21:09 Uhr

 
Statusbot

Release status: experimental [box doku]

Beschreibung

Features

Der aktuelle Status kann über http://www.raumzeitlabor.de (oben rechts), über die Webapp oder im IRC via !!raum status abgerufen werden.

Der Raumstatus wird automatisch durch einen Schalter in der Tür gesetzt.

IRC

In den Räumen #oqlt und #raumzeitlabor (hackint) kann der Status via !!raum abgefragt werden. Zusätzlich können über '!weristda' die anwesenden RaumZeitLaboranten ausgegeben werden. Voraussetzung hierfür ist, dass diese in der BenutzerDB die MAC-Adressen ihrer Netzwerkadapter hinterlegt haben. Mit !stream wird der aktuell über den MPD abgespielte Musiktitel angezeigt.

Mobile Webapp

http://status.raumzeitlabor.de/mobile.php (iPhone optimiert)

Web 2.0 Zeugs

Der Status wird auch auf Identi.ca und auf Twitter veröffentlicht. Der Account lautet bei beiden Netzwerken RaumZeitStatus

RSS

Identi.ca hat einen öffentlichen RSS-Feed über welchen der Status auch ohne Identi.ca Account abgefragt werden kann. Den Feed gibts unter http://identi.ca/api/statuses/user_timeline/191025.rss

Technik

Auf der Firebox läuft ein Daemon (tuerstatusd.pl), der die HTTP-API des Hausbus abfragt und den Status ins Netz (sprich: auf den RZL-Server) veröffentlicht.

Geplant

  • Status in den drei IRC-Channels im Topic
  • Status im IRC-Channel automatisch posten